In science, upthrust refers to the upward force exerted on an object immersed in a fluid (liquid or gas). It is a type of buoyant force that counteracts the weight of the object, causing it to float or rise. Upthrust is dependent on the density of the fluid and the volume of the object displaced.
No, upthrust is not a scalar quantity. It is a vector quantity as it has both magnitude and direction. Upthrust is the upward force exerted by a fluid on an object immersed in it, and its direction is always opposite to the direction of gravity.
The submarine will sink if its weight is greater than the upthrust acting on it. Upthrust is the force pushing an object upwards in a fluid, such as water. When an object's weight is greater than the upthrust, it will sink.

The force that acts against upthrust is gravity. Gravity pulls objects downward, opposing the buoyant force provided by upthrust.
To find the upthrust needed to keep a 1600 N object afloat, you need to consider the weight of the object. The upthrust must equal the weight of the object for it to stay afloat, so the upthrust required would be 1600 N.

This is the name given to a bouyancey force. When an object diplaces a fluid, the amount of upthrust received is proportional to the volume of fluid displaced. When an object is floating then the upthrust is equal to the objects weight. When more people get on to a boat, the boat sinks further into the water, displacing more water so that the upthrust increases to balance the new weight. If an object sinks then the amount of upthrust it receives is less than the weight so the object falls. Just because it sinks doesn't mean that there is no upthrust, there is. This is why heavy objects appear lighter if you place them in water.
